Dragon Flight Reimagined: A New Spin on an Old Favorite

A long‑time fan of the beloved game series has released a fresh version that feels both familiar and new. The developers kept the classic dragon spirit but added modern graphics and smoother controls that make flying feel more natural.

Instead of following the original storyline, this edition starts with a mystery: the dragon’s wing is damaged. Players must explore hidden caves and solve puzzles to repair it, which gives the game a new sense of urgency.

The updated sound design uses 3D audio, so every roar and wingbeat seems to come from the direction you look. This subtle change makes the world feel more alive and less like a flat screen.

The game’s difficulty has been tweaked to be friendlier for younger players, yet it still offers challenging boss fights for veterans. The new “challenge mode” lets users test their skills against time limits and score multipliers.

Behind the scenes, the team used a new physics engine that simulates wind currents. This means the dragon’s flight path reacts to environmental changes, encouraging players to think about how they navigate.

Because the plot is open‑ended, you can choose different paths that lead to multiple endings. This replay value encourages experimentation and creative problem‑solving.

Overall, the remake respects its roots while offering fresh mechanics that keep both new and old fans engaged. It shows how classic ideas can be refreshed with thoughtful updates.
